Output af1034e435c18f3a5a6b149492c24985f99b7aae905d20fa2d6d7d8388794aee:25

value
3096699
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a9911d2971defe38918275014f2ed4e0e1910be OP_EQUALVERIFY OP_CHECKSIG
address
1DdqcwJSnKKLu49DmftoWX76vNS4GqqsBR
transaction
af1034e435c18f3a5a6b149492c24985f99b7aae905d20fa2d6d7d8388794aee
spent
true